# Forgemove Migration — Env Vars

Hermetic builds under Brickline ignore ambient shell vars. Everything must be declared in the env file checked by the fetch step. Paths are container-relative. Cache is keyed on file hash, so edits force rebuilds. The remote cache requires an auth token, set on the following line of the env file:

secret setting of yagef-baweg: RELAY_SECRET29=cb53deb59a49ed54d9f43599b54ca

**Ticket: Firmware channel config drift on Lanternbox beta ring**

The Lanternbox beta update channel no longer matches what our plugin manifests declare. Rollout percentage and signing policy were changed manually last week without updating the shared baseline, so plugin authors are seeing inconsistent update prompts. Please reconcile against the baseline. For reference, the values currently live on the channel are below.

deployment values, yadug-bawif:
[framir]
team = pelox
access_code = ac_a38ab2
owner = tamion.julael
host = framir.tolvaqlabs.test
port = 11211
peer = tammir.zemvargrid.local
salt = 2215ef03
pin = 1541

## Runbook: Driver assignment gone sideways (FleetHopper)

If riders in the Ostwick zone are waiting ages, the assignment heuristic is probably starving the outer ring. Check the scoring weights first — nine times out of ten someone bumped the proximity weight and forgot distance decay. Restart the matcher after any change. The matcher currently boots with these values.

service settings:
[casax]
port = 6379
team = rusir
host = casax.zemvarhq.corp
region = outer-4
access_code = ac_9808ce
timeout_ms = 1500

strings-extract.sh — Maintainer Note

This script pulls translatable strings from the Quillbank web client and pushes them to Lingovale, our translation vendor. Runs nightly via cron on the build box. Do not hand-edit the generated .pot files; they get overwritten. If Lingovale changes their upload API (happened twice), bump the client in tools/lingovale-cli and re-run with --dry-run first. Contract renewal is each March; flag issues well before then. Vendor-side failures go to their support queue, reachable at the address below.

pager mailbox: silael.sorwyn.tamius@zemvarsys.corp